The Essentials of Metal Finishing - Most frequently, metal finishing is necessary for aesthetic reasons and for clean-room uses. It's among the most recognized solutions due to its success in intensifying the original beauty of the item, as an example, motor bike parts, motor vehicle parts or kitchenware. Also, numerous clean-rooms demand a lustrous finish in order to lower the penetrability of the material that may cause debris to build up and contaminate. An demonstration of this implementation might be in a vacuum chamber. There are quite a few strategies to finish metal, and we'll look into examples of the processes involved. Metals may be finished electromechanically, by means of chemicals, manually, or with purpose built buffing machines. A finishing compound or paste is regularly utilized, which can include ch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scosity is commonly one of the most time intensive. On the other side, items composed of non-ferrous metals tend to be receptive to finishing, as these require the lowest number of operations.
When a superior processing quality isn't called for, higher pad speeds may be employed. A slower pad speed must be used in the event that a superior mirror finish is mandatory. Finishing buffs bedaubed with paste can be very much affected by the forces on the polish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face might be increased within certain constraints, having said that, going over the most effective amount of force not only cuts down the quality level of treatment, but also can degrade efficiency, can bring about wear on the product, and furthermore an evident heating of the pieces being worked on, as a result of friction. When you are working on thinner objects, it's greater temperature (and a ensuing bendability of the material) that causes materials to flex, buckle or twist. As a rule, it takes a trained polisher to take into consideration every one of these fundamentals to equally prevent harm to the piece and to perform efficiently. For you to substantially increase the standard of the final surface area, the buffing process is required to be executed with a reduced amount of vigour and not so much pressure in order to in the end deliver a surface area devoid of scratches or marks which result from the buffing process, therefore ar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
